When driving with my son in the Dallas area a couple of weeks ago, I discovered that Texas is tearing out toll booths. Technology at work. As new, disruptive technologies emerge, what jobs within associations are similar to a toll booth worker? Using the cost savings to pay for upgraded technology? Just cutting the costs?
